Bijan Robinson vs Jonathan Taylor: Dynasty Trade Value Comparison
Bijan Robinson currently holds a 48% edge in Superflex dynasty value.
| Bijan Robinson | Jonathan Taylor |
| SF Value | 10,088 | 5,214 |
| Position | RB | RB |
| Team | ATL | IND |
| Age | 24.5 | 27.5 |
| Rank | #2 | #27 |
The Case for Bijan Robinson
Bijan Robinson is 24.5 and priced like an elite cornerstone: SF Value 10,088 (RB2) with a +129 30-day trend. That age gives you a longer runway than most top RBs, and the market is reinforcing it with upward momentum. In Atlanta, he’s positioned as the offense’s centerpiece with multi-year security and receiving upside that stabilizes weekly floors. You’re paying for prime-years insulation and a profile that holds value even through normal RB volatility.
The Case for Jonathan Taylor
Jonathan Taylor is 27.5 with an SF Value of 5,214 (RB27) and a -167 30-day trend, which signals the market is actively discounting his future. The Colts can still feed him volume and he has proven week-winning ceiling when the offense is functioning. His price is now more about immediate production than long-term insulation, making him a classic contender buy if you need RB points. The risk is the age curve plus market softness—if you miss a peak season, the value floor can fall fast.
Verdict by Team Situation
If you're contending: Contenders should prefer Bijan Robinson unless Taylor is a clear points upgrade for your lineup at a steep discount.
If you're rebuilding: Rebuilders should prefer Bijan Robinson because the 3-year age edge and positive trend make him the far better value anchor.
If value is close: If values are close, take Bijan Robinson and only pivot to Taylor if you’re packaging the savings into a meaningful second starter or premium pick.
